<p class="MsoNormal" style=""><span
 style="font-family: &quot;TimesNewRomanPSMT&quot;,&quot;serif&quot;;" lang="FR-CA">Stephen
Harper se plaît à dire
que l’électorat a rejeté un gouvernement libéral dirigé par Stéphane
Dion
lors des dernières élections. Ce n’est pas tout à fait juste. Lors de
l’élection, chaque citoyen vote pour un représentant de sa
circonscription,
et non pour le premier ministre ni pour le gouvernement. Nous sommes
dans un
système parlementaire (on élit un Parlement) et non un système
présidentiel (o</span><span lang="FR-CA">ù</span><span
 style="font-family: &quot;TimesNewRomanPSMT&quot;,&quot;serif&quot;;" lang="FR-CA">
on y élit un président). C’est en fait la Gouverneure Générale qui
demande au chef du parti qui a obtenu le plus de sièges de former un
gouvernement. Cette demande est basée sur la supposition que ce parti a
le plus
de chances d’obtenir la confiance de la Chambre des communes, une
confiance essentielle à l’exercice des pouvoirs législatif du
gouvernement.
Un système parlementaire lie le pouvoir exécutif et législatif d’un
gouvernement dans les mains des gens élus au Parlement. Donc, oui,
Stephen
Harper a raison quand il dit que les Canadiens n’ont pas élu un
gouvernement de coalition. Tout comme nous n’avons pas voté directement
pour un gouvernement conservateur minoritaire ni pour lui (sauf à
Calgary
Ouest). L’élection ne détermine pas qui forme le gouvernement; un
«&nbsp;gagnant&nbsp;» ou un «&nbsp;perdant&nbsp;». Elle
identifie qui forme le
regroupement de députés. Et c’est de ce groupe qu’émane le
gouvernement.</span><span

I started studying Spanish when I started learning back in December 2006,
back when I got married in Cuba. I found myself fascinated with this
language that was so close to French, yet wasn't French at all. French
is my first language which was a real gift from my parents and my
minority French speaking community. Growing up in Winnipeg, English is
learnt more easily growing up here as it is the most spoken language.
Learning is very different as I am learning as an adult. The adult mind
is harder to train with languages as is the mind of a child.<br>
<br>
I
wanted to share the ressources and strategies that I have found useful
in learning Spanish. The bulk of the ressources what I have used is
media that interested me. This media includes books, movies with
Spanish audio and subtitles, online radio, online news clips, online
dictionnaries and other. <a
 href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Language_immersion">Immersion</a>
is my primary strategy, though I did take a couple of weeks of classes
in Guatemala to give me a bit of a formal base. Individual classes were
ideal as I already had a base in the langugage and my teachers were
able to adapt to my needs. I also used recordings where words are given
to you in a language that you understand and repeated in the lanugage
that you are learning, these I was able to find in Airports and able to
borrow at the <a href="http://wpl.city.winnipeg.mb.ca/library/">Winnipeg
Public Library</a>. The best practise of course is
to speak it with a native speaker.<br>
<br>
I try and expose myself to
the language as much as possible. Some of the strategies that have
worked for me have included listening to Spanish recordings in the car
and listening to Spanish recordings when I have a spare moment on my
portable audio player while walking the dogs or while doing household
chores. I have also found that reading out loud is good to practise
pronunciation.<br>
